Man from Wichita found guilty of Riverside double homicide

A 63-year-old man from Wichita has been found guilty of murdering two individuals in a Riverside residence last year.

Charles Crawford entered a plea of no contest on Thursday to two counts of first-degree murder in the tragic deaths of Vanessa Crawford, 50, and Donald Eckert, 58. Initially facing a capital murder charge, Charles has now pleaded no contest to the aforementioned charges.

On the morning of July 25, 2023, Wichita police received a call regarding a woman who attempted to drop off her child at a daycare center near 11th and Woodrow. Upon arrival, the officers encountered a situation where they were unable to enter the residence. Peering inside, they discovered two victims slumped over.

EMS was unsuccessful in resuscitating the two victims.

During the investigation, the officers observed Crawford carrying a firearm and expressing suicidal thoughts in the vicinity of 12th and Woodrow. They apprehended him approximately two hours later.

Crawford’s sentencing is set for February 10.
